One of the greatest of the classic greek tragedies and a masterpiece of dramatic construction. catastrophe ensues when king oedipus discovers he has inadvertently killed his father and married his mother. masterly use of dramatic irony greatly intensifies impact of agonizing events.

In her article, oedipal textuality: reading freud's reading of oedipus, cynthia chase explains oedipus rex as a story of psychoanalysis in relation to the riddles in the story and oedipus trying to uncover his truth. Oedipus rex is arguably the most important tragedy in all of classical literature. There are traces in oedipus of the pre hellenic medicine king, the basileus who is also a theos, and can make rain or blue sky, pestilence or fertility. this explains many things in the priest's first speech, in the attitude of the chorus, and in oedipus' own language after [pg vi] the discovery.

Chorus look ye, countrymen and thebans, this is oedipus the great, he who knew the sphinx's riddle and was mightiest in our state. who of all our townsmen gazed not on his fame with envious eyes? now, in what a sea of troubles sunk and overwhelmed he lies! therefore wait to see life's ending ere thou count one mortal blest;. This public domain core collection book was created using francis storr’s 1912 loeb library translation of sophocles’s oedipus rex courtesy of project gutenberg. · in homer’s the odyssey, odysseus sees oedipus’ mother in the underworld, with her name being epicaste not jocasta. · in the odyssey, oedipus’ story is told from the mother’s perspective, and oedipus’ end seems to be even worse due to his mother’s “avenging spirits”.
